This is what the iPhone 17 Pro looks like with a new design

In about two months, Apple will unveil the iPhone 17 series. Now, new renderings have emerged showing the design of the iPhone 17 Pro. Particularly striking are a new material mix and an unusual placement of the Apple logo. The images come from leaker Majin Bu and provide more clarity than previous reports.

Rumors and initial hints about the upcoming iPhone generation have been circulating for months. Now a new image is attracting attention: It shows the iPhone 17 Pro with a split case and an Apple logo that is no longer exactly centered on the back. Instead, it is centered on a glass element. The authenticity of the leak has since been confirmed by a second well-known leaker, Sonny Dickson. This adds to the evidence that Apple is indeed tweaking the design of the iPhone 17 Pro.

New aluminum housing

Apple is apparently changing the material for the iPhone 17 Pro. Instead of using titanium as before, the casing—more specifically, the frame and camera unit—will be made entirely of aluminum. This is a rather unusual move, as aluminum, while lighter, is more susceptible to scratches. The new material could offer noticeable advantages for users, especially in terms of weight.

Glass element for MagSafe and Wireless

Despite the aluminum construction, a glass element is still installed on the back. This serves as a technical window for MagSafe, wireless charging, and possibly also for wireless data transfer. The casing is therefore not entirely made of metal, but follows a hybrid approach: aluminum meets glass – functionally separated.

Apple logo moves to the piece of glass

One of the most striking design features is the repositioned Apple logo. It's no longer in the center of the entire back, as usual, but is centered on the glass element, which in turn doesn't take up the entire back. The result: From a geometric perspective, the logo sits somewhat lower than usual. Many found this disconcerting at first, but thanks to the new glass division, the positioning makes technical sense.

Design decision with system

Even if the new logo position seems unusual at first glance, it's probably no coincidence. It marks the exact glass element that's crucial for wireless functionality. Whether this is just a visual gimmick or a hint of new technology inside remains to be seen. One thing is clear: Apple doesn't just want to change the design, but possibly also adapt it functionally.

Reliable leaks shortly before launch

Majin Bu, who first saw the new picture published is no stranger to the scene. Many of his previous leaks have turned out to be accurate. The quick confirmation by Sonny Dickson – also known for reliable Apple pre-release information – suggests that we're seeing a fairly realistic picture of the final design of the iPhone 17 Pro.

iPhone 17 Pro focuses on visible change

The iPhone 17 Pro features a new casing material, a two-piece back design with a glass element, and a repositioned Apple logo. These design changes are based on technical reasons, but they also significantly alter the look of the iPhone. Whether everyone will like this will become clear after the official launch in September. One thing is clear: anyone looking for an iPhone with a fresh look should keep an eye on the iPhone 17 Pro.
